What Does a Flooring SEO Strategy Actually Look Like?
A strong local SEO campaign for a Fort Worth flooring company has four working parts: your Google Business Profile, your website’s on-page content, your backlink profile, and your review velocity. Ignore any one of those and the other three underperform.
Google Business Profile Optimization
Your GBP is the single highest-leverage asset you have in local search. For flooring companies in Rivercrest and the broader west Fort Worth market, that means selecting the right primary category (typically “Flooring Store” or “Flooring Contractor” depending on your model), adding every service you offer as a secondary category, uploading geo-tagged photos of completed jobs in the area, and publishing weekly posts that mention specific neighborhoods like Rivercrest, Monticello, and Berkeley Place. Google reads those neighborhood signals and uses them to match your profile to hyperlocal searches.
Location-Specific Website Pages
If your website has one generic “Service Area” page listing fifteen cities, it ranks for none of them. Each major service-area neighborhood deserves its own page with unique content — real details about the housing stock in that area, the floor types that perform well in Fort Worth’s climate, and social proof from jobs completed nearby. Pages targeting Rivercrest, Westover Hills, Ridglea Hills, and River Oaks will each capture a distinct segment of searches that your competitors’ generic sites miss entirely.
Technical SEO Foundations
A slow website kills conversions before SEO even gets a chance to work. Google’s Search Central documentation is clear that Core Web Vitals are a ranking factor, and flooring company websites — often loaded with before-and-after photo galleries — are notoriously slow. Schema markup, proper heading structure, and mobile-first design round out the technical baseline every Fort Worth flooring site needs before off-page work begins.
Local Seasonality and Market Conditions in Fort Worth
Fort Worth’s climate creates predictable demand spikes that a smart SEO calendar can front-run. Summer heat and humidity push homeowners toward luxury vinyl plank over solid hardwood in lower-level rooms — searches for “LVP installation Fort Worth” spike from May through August. Fall brings the pre-holiday renovation rush, and January sees a second wave as homeowners cash in gift cards and use year-end savings. A flooring company with seasonal content published six to eight weeks ahead of those spikes captures that demand; one with a static website watches it pass.
The Rivercrest neighborhood itself sits in a flood-adjacent zone along the West Fork Trinity River. Homeowners here have real anxiety about moisture-sensitive flooring products, which creates an opportunity: content that addresses waterproof flooring options for Trinity River-area homes ranks well AND converts at a higher rate because it speaks directly to a local concern no national chain will bother to address.

Frequently Asked Questions: SEO for Flooring Companies in Rivercrest, Fort Worth
How long does SEO take to work for a flooring company in Fort Worth?
Most flooring companies in competitive Fort Worth markets see measurable movement in local rankings within three to five months when on-page, GBP, and off-page work are all running simultaneously. Map Pack entry often comes faster than organic ranking improvements. Full ROI typically becomes clear at the six-month mark.
Do I need a separate page for Rivercrest on my website?
Yes. A dedicated location page for Rivercrest — with unique content, local details, and proper schema markup — sends stronger geographic signals to Google than a single service-area page listing dozens of cities. It also converts better because it speaks directly to the homeowner in that neighborhood.
What’s the most important ranking factor for flooring companies in local search?
Your Google Business Profile is the single most influential factor for Map Pack rankings. Review count, review recency, category accuracy, and consistent NAP (name, address, phone) data across the web all feed into how Google ranks your profile against competitors in the Fort Worth area.
Should I run Google Ads alongside SEO for my Fort Worth flooring business?
In competitive markets like west Fort Worth, running Google Ads while SEO builds momentum is a smart short-term play. Ads deliver immediate visibility; SEO builds long-term, lower-cost lead generation. Once your organic rankings are solid, many flooring companies scale back or pause paid spend.
How do reviews impact SEO for flooring contractors?
Reviews directly influence your Map Pack ranking and your conversion rate. Google weighs review volume, average star rating, and the recency of new reviews. A flooring company with 60 recent, detailed reviews will outrank a competitor with 15 older reviews, all else being equal. A systematic review request process is a non-negotiable part of a Fort Worth flooring SEO strategy.
